Inspecting Your Steering Control Arm for Damage: A Step-by-Step Guide
Your vehicle’s steering control arm, also known as an A-arm or wishbone, is a vital component connecting the wheel hub to the vehicle’s frame. It plays a critical role in maintaining proper wheel alignment and absorbing road shocks. Regular inspection can prevent serious safety issues and costly repairs down the line.

How to Check Your Steering Control Arm for Damage
Before you begin, ensure your vehicle is parked on a level surface and the parking brake is engaged. It’s also a good idea to have wheel chocks in place for added safety. You’ll need a flashlight and potentially a pry bar for some checks.
Visual Inspection: What to Look For
The first step is a thorough visual check. Get down and look at the control arms on both sides of the front wheels.
- Cracks and Bends: Look for any visible cracks, bends, or deformations in the metal of the control arm. Even minor bends can affect alignment.
- Rust and Corrosion: Excessive rust or corrosion can weaken the metal over time, making it susceptible to failure. Pay close attention to welds and mounting points.
- Damaged Bushings: The control arm is connected to the frame via bushings, usually made of rubber or polyurethane. Check these for cracks, tears, or signs of deterioration. Worn bushings will appear flattened or separated.
Checking for Play and Looseness
With the vehicle safely supported (ideally on jack stands, with wheels off the ground), you can check for play in the control arm.
- Grip the Wheel: Firmly grip the tire at the top and bottom.
- Wiggle: Try to wiggle the wheel back and forth. Any clunking or excessive movement that doesn’t feel like it’s coming from the steering wheel itself could indicate a problem with the control arm or its associated components.
- Side-to-Side: Repeat the process by gripping the tire on the sides and attempting to rock it in and out.
Assessing Ball Joints and Tie Rod Ends
While inspecting the control arm, it’s also wise to check its related components. The ball joint connects the control arm to the steering knuckle, and tie rod ends connect the steering rack to the knuckle.
- Ball Joints: Look for torn or damaged boots around the ball joint. If you can move the ball joint by hand or detect significant play when wiggling the wheel, it may need replacement.
- Tie Rod Ends: Check the boots on the tie rod ends for tears. Similar to ball joints, excessive play here will affect steering.
Signs of a Damaged Steering Control Arm
Recognizing the symptoms of a damaged steering control arm can help you identify problems before they become severe.
- Pulling to One Side: If your car consistently pulls to the left or right, even on a straight road, it could be a sign of a bent control arm or alignment issues.
- Uneven Tire Wear: You might notice faster wear on the inside or outside edges of your tires. This is a classic symptom of alignment problems stemming from control arm damage.
- Vibrations: Excessive vibrations felt through the steering wheel or the chassis, especially at higher speeds, can indicate a bent control arm.
- Clunking Noises: You may hear clunking or rattling noises when going over bumps or making turns. This often points to worn bushings or loose components.
- Steering Wheel Off-Center: If your steering wheel is not centered when driving straight, it’s a strong indicator of an alignment issue, potentially caused by a control arm problem.

### What happens if a steering control arm breaks?
If a steering control arm breaks while driving, it can lead to a sudden and complete loss of steering control. This is an extremely dangerous situation that can result in a serious accident. The wheel can detach or turn uncontrollably, making it impossible to direct the vehicle.
### How much does it cost to replace a steering control arm?
The cost to replace a steering control arm can vary significantly based on your vehicle’s make and model, as well as your location. Generally, you can expect to pay anywhere from $300 to $800 or more for parts and labor. This often includes alignment after the replacement.
### Can I drive with a damaged steering control arm?
It is not recommended to drive with a damaged steering control arm. Even minor damage can compromise your vehicle’s alignment and handling, leading to uneven tire wear and reduced braking effectiveness. It significantly increases the risk of a catastrophic failure while driving.
### How often should steering control arms be inspected?
Steering control arms should ideally be inspected as part of your vehicle’s regular maintenance schedule, typically during oil changes or tire rotations. Most mechanics recommend an inspection every 12,000 to 15,000 miles or at least once a year to ensure they are in good condition.
